I have my favorites, it would be nice to know which ones are your favorites, I'm always up to a good recommendation. My recent binge was a Korean drama called "Vincenzo". It's 20 episodes, 1 episode runs about 1h 20min. It is on Korean language, english subtitled.
The story is about a Korean born man, who is adopted at a young age by an Italian mafia , and brought up to be a mafia layer. He helps a Chinese mafia boss to hide his gold in Korea. This Chinese boss dies, and the only person knows about the hidden gold is Vincenzo. He travels back to Korea to recover the gold, just to learn, that getting to the gold is not so easy.
The series is seriously entertaining, it is humorous, gory, intriguing in one package. I don't want to say more about it, you may would like to watch it. Here is a trailer:

I just watched HBO's The Nevers and I must say it started out quite well. The fifth episode was the best but something happened as the writers decided to spoon feed us for the mid season finale. Why do they insist us viewers are so stupid? We like the stories to take their time to develop.
The added future scenes at the beginning of episode 6 were your generic action science fiction. Then we get a long back story before we reach a rather muddled climax. What was a quite good science fiction series based in Edwardian England is now about time traveling aliens.
I will not be back when the second half of the series begins.
